Russia questions value of Nabucco energy pipeline

Moscow has questioned the viability of the EU-backed Nabucco energy corridor, a pipeline designed to lessen the bloc's dependency on Russia.

"I know few things about political geography. The only way to fill the Nabucco pipeline is to rely on Iranian gas," Russian ambassador to the EU Vladimir Chizhov told journalists earlier this week (15 April).
